What to Eat

Middelfart has a variety of restaurants serving traditional Danish cuisine as well as international dishes.

  • Smørrebrød: This is a traditional Danish open-faced sandwich that is typically served with various toppings, such as herring, salmon, or cheese.
  • Frikadeller: These are Danish meatballs that are typically served with mashed potatoes and gravy.
  • Æbleskiver: These are Danish pancakes that are typically served with jam and powdered sugar.
